
Bollywood actress Alia Bhatt was spotted in Mumbai last night i.e. on February 23, a video related to it has surfaced, where she is looking gorgeous in a pink oversized suit. Alia appeared in the video with full security. During this, the actress also smiled and posed for the paparazzi. Two days back when Alia was resting at her home, a publication clicked her private pictures, that too without her consent. Despite this act, Alia met the paparazzi while smiling. As soon as this video comes in front, the fans are praising the simplicity of the actress.
understand the whole matter
Alia Bhatt informed us about this incident on February 22 through Instagram. He shared a post on social media. Posting, Alia wrote, 'Are you kidding me? I was at my home and having a normal afternoon. I was sitting in my living room when I felt someone watching me. I saw two people clicking me from my neighbor's building. In what world is it okay to do this to someone?'
Alia further wrote, 'Can anyone get permission to do this easily? Isn't this infringing on someone's privacy? There is a line that you cannot cross. And it would be safe for me to say that you have crossed all the lines. Along with this, Alia also tagged the Mumbai Police for help. Now after this case, Alia's husband Ranbir Kapoor has increased her security.
